Comment (by cswiercz):

 As mentioned in an email correspondence with '''chapoton''' I believe my
 implementation of `PuiseuxSeriesRing` and `PuiseuxSeriesRingElement`to be
 pretty complete in regards to fitting into Sage's coercion model.
 Hopefully it will, at the very least, be a good starting point.

 Thanks to '''chapoton''' for offering to plug this code into Sage!

 On a side note, I also have some code for computing Puiseux series
 representations of places on a plane algebraic curve. The entry function
 is `abelfunctions.puiseux_series.puiseux_series`. I'm sure someone with
 better Sage skills than myself can improve the algorithm and plug that in
 as well.
